[Freeswitch-users] Possible bug in playback: local_stream://moh

Nuno Reis nreis at wavecom.pt
Wed Dec 11 04:32:07 MSK 2013


Hi Anthony.

Thanks for getting involved in this thread. Only today I've been able to
compile the latest stable on my CentOS 6.4 production pipe. I have been
dealing with the endless loop issue (FS-5956) during compile time until now.
I've manage to figure out the problem and rolled-back some changes on some
Makefiles. A patch showing those changes follows attached. I've also
attached the patch in jira's (FS-5956). I hope that can be helpful to solve
that annoying problem, it seems to appear only in CentOS (maybe on other
redhat based distros).
Regarding the playback of local_sream://moh i can tell that it is solved in
v1.2stable HEAD.
Thank you Brian for trying to help me hunting down this issue, although for
now everything is working again as expected, no further action is needed.

Cheers,

--

*Nuno Miguel Reis* | *Unified Communication** Systems*
M. +351 913907481 | nreis at wavecom.pt
WAVECOM-Soluções Rádio, S.A.
Cacia Park | Rua do Progresso, Lote 15
3800-639 AVEIRO | Portugal
T. +351 309 700 225 | F. +351 234 919 191
*GPS
<http://maps.google.com/maps/ms?msa=0&msid=202333747613191340808.0004b4b227a6144f0df88>
| www.wavecom.pt <http://www.wavecom.pt/>** <http://www.wavecom.pt/>*

[image: Description: Description:
WavecomSignature]<http://www.wavecom.pt/pt/wavecom/premios.php>

[image: Publicity] <http://www.wavecom.pt/pt/mail_eventos.php>




On Tue, Dec 10, 2013 at 6:40 PM, Anthony Minessale <
anthony.minessale at gmail.com> wrote:

> You're moving too slow.  Try HEAD of 1.2. By the time you wen't and got
> 1.2.14 1.2.15 is released with 1.2.16 in the wings.
>
>
>
> On Tue, Dec 10, 2013 at 10:58 AM, Nuno Reis <nreis at wavecom.pt> wrote:
>
>> Hi Brian.
>>
>> I can confirm that media flows do exist, although the byte pattern that i
>> get with ngrep looks always the same when a call the local_stream://moh.
>> The media pattern for playback(local_stream://moh) can be seen here<http://pastebin.freeswitch.org/21732>
>> .
>> The media pattern for
>> playback(tone_stream://path=${base_dir}/conf/tetris.ttml) which is
>> *audible* can be seen here <http://pastebin.freeswitch.org/21733>.
>>
>> In the meanwhile I've updated my code tree from commit
>> (456f69a62b2fa4df7ac8438b30ba68e74c2a04fc) which corresponds to v1.2stable
>> FS 1.2.14 to commit (cb4a26af0d7121f0e32a53333182b66ce9ca9747).
>> After the update i wasn't able to compile again (i'm trying to figure out
>> what is causing the endless loop), you can see why in the attached email
>> which I've sent to the freeswitch-dev mailing list last Friday.
>>
>> Looking forward to hear from you again.
>>
>> Best Regards,
>>
>> --
>>
>> *Nuno Miguel Reis* | *Unified Communication** Systems*
>> M. +351 913907481 | nreis at wavecom.pt
>> WAVECOM-Soluções Rádio, S.A.
>> Cacia Park | Rua do Progresso, Lote 15
>> 3800-639 AVEIRO | Portugal
>> T. +351 309 700 225 | F. +351 234 919 191
>> *GPS
>> <http://maps.google.com/maps/ms?msa=0&msid=202333747613191340808.0004b4b227a6144f0df88>
>> | www.wavecom.pt <http://www.wavecom.pt/>** <http://www.wavecom.pt/>*
>>
>> [image: Description: Description: WavecomSignature]<http://www.wavecom.pt/pt/wavecom/premios.php>
>>
>> [image: Publicity] <http://www.wavecom.pt/pt/mail_eventos.php>
>>
>>
>>
>>
>> ---------- Forwarded message ----------
>> From: Nuno Reis <nreis at wavecom.pt>
>> Date: Fri, Dec 6, 2013 at 7:30 PM
>> Subject: endless recusive process fork during build of latest stable in
>> centOS 6.4
>> To: freeswitch-dev at lists.freeswitch.org
>>
>>
>>  Hi guys.
>>
>> I've just tried to compile the latest stable 1.2v branch and I'm getting
>> stuck on an endless process fork as seen here<http://pastebin.freeswitch.org/21724>(ps fax output)
>>
>> This is a freeswitch RPM production pipe system on a centOS 6.4 x86_64.
>>
>> The latest version successfully compiled here was commit
>> (456f69a62b2fa4df7ac8438b30ba68e74c2a04fc).
>>
>> Should i open another Jira for this? It looks like FS-5956 already
>> addresses this issue or something quite similar.
>>
>> Looking forward to hear from you.
>>
>> BR,
>>
>> --
>>
>> *Nuno Miguel Reis* | *Unified Communication** Systems*
>> M. +351 913907481 | nreis at wavecom.pt
>> WAVECOM-Soluções Rádio, S.A.
>> Cacia Park | Rua do Progresso, Lote 15
>> 3800-639 AVEIRO | Portugal
>> T. +351 309 700 225 | F. +351 234 919 191
>> *GPS
>> <http://maps.google.com/maps/ms?msa=0&msid=202333747613191340808.0004b4b227a6144f0df88>
>> | www.wavecom.pt <http://www.wavecom.pt/>** <http://www.wavecom.pt/>*
>>
>> [image: Description: Description: WavecomSignature]<http://www.wavecom.pt/pt/wavecom/premios.php>
>>
>> [image: Publicity] <http://www.wavecom.pt/pt/mail_eventos.php>
>>
>>
>>
>> On Mon, Dec 9, 2013 at 6:08 PM, Brian West <brian at freeswitch.org> wrote:
>>
>>> Nuno,
>>>         Well have you actually looked at the signaling of the phone
>>> calls to verify media is flowing?
>>> --
>>> Brian West
>>> brian at freeswitch.org
>>> FreeSWITCH Solutions, LLC
>>> PO BOX 2531
>>> Brookfield, WI 53008-2531
>>> Twitter: @FreeSWITCH_Wire , @briankwest
>>> http://www.freeswitchbook.com
>>> http://www.freeswitchcookbook.com
>>>
>>> T: +1.918.420.9001  |  F: +1.918.420.9002  |  M: +1.918.424.WEST
>>> iNUM: +883 5100 1420 9001
>>> ISN: 410*543
>>> Skype:briankwest
>>> PGP Key: http://www.bkw.org/key.txt (AB93356707C76CED)
>>>
>>>
>>>
>>>
>>>
>>>
>>>
>>>
>>>
>>>
>>>
>>>
>>> On Dec 6, 2013, at 9:04 AM, Nuno Reis <nreis at wavecom.pt> wrote:
>>>
>>> > Hi guys!
>>> >
>>> > An update on this issue, local_stream also works fine in Version
>>> 1.5.7b git 7a77d2f.
>>> > I'll try to update my stable version from 1.2.14 to the latest stable
>>> and let's see what happens.
>>> > I'll update again when i have more info.
>>> >
>>> > --
>>> >
>>> > Nuno Miguel Reis | Unified Communication Systems
>>> > M. +351 913907481 | nreis at wavecom.pt
>>> >
>>> > WAVECOM-Soluções Rádio, S.A.
>>> > Cacia Park | Rua do Progresso, Lote 15
>>> > 3800-639 AVEIRO | Portugal
>>> > T. +351 309 700 225 | F. +351 234 919 191
>>> > GPS | www.wavecom.pt
>>> >
>>> > <image001.png>
>>> >
>>> >
>>> >
>>> >
>>> >
>>> >
>>> >
>>> >
>>> > On Fri, Dec 6, 2013 at 1:10 AM, Nuno Reis <nreis at wavecom.pt> wrote:
>>> > Hi guys.
>>> >
>>> > I've just noticed that playback of local_stream://moh stopped working
>>> after upgrading from FS 1.2.3 to 1.2.14
>>> >
>>> > Here's the tail output from the dailplan in FS 1.2.3 (everything
>>> works):
>>> > ...
>>> > EXECUTE sofia/internal/nmreis at domain1_2_3 playback(local_stream://moh)
>>> > 2013-12-06 00:54:42.099381 [DEBUG] mod_local_stream.c:417 Opening
>>> Stream [moh/8000] 8000hz
>>> > 2013-12-06 00:54:42.099381 [DEBUG] switch_ivr_play_say.c:1309 Codec
>>> Activated L16 at 8000hz 1 channels 20ms
>>> > ...
>>> >
>>> > Here's the tail output from the dailplan in FS 1.2.14 (everything
>>> still seems to be ok but i can't hear any sound):
>>> > ...
>>> > EXECUTE sofia/internal/nmreis at domain_1_2_14playback(local_stream://moh)
>>> > 2013-12-06 00:57:46.057502 [DEBUG] mod_local_stream.c:498 Opening
>>> Stream [moh/8000] 8000hz
>>> > 2013-12-06 00:57:46.057502 [DEBUG] switch_ivr_play_say.c:1319 Codec
>>> Activated L16 at 8000hz 1 channels 20ms
>>> > ...
>>> >
>>> > This issue is happening accross several FSs running 1.2.14.
>>> > The only FSs where i'm able to hear moh are on the old 1.2.3 versions.
>>> >
>>> > Anyone experiencing the same thing? Any hints?
>>> >
>>> > Looking forward to hear from you.
>>> >
>>> > BR,
>>> > --
>>> >
>>> > Nuno Miguel Reis | Unified Communication Systems
>>> > M. +351 913907481 | nreis at wavecom.pt
>>> >
>>> > WAVECOM-Soluções Rádio, S.A.
>>> > Cacia Park | Rua do Progresso, Lote 15
>>> > 3800-639 AVEIRO | Portugal
>>> > T. +351 309 700 225 | F. +351 234 919 191
>>> > GPS | www.wavecom.pt
>>> >
>>> > <image001.png>
>>> >
>>> >
>>> >
>>> >
>>> >
>>> >
>>> >
>>> >
>>> _________________________________________________________________________
>>> > Professional FreeSWITCH Consulting Services:
>>> > consulting at freeswitch.org
>>> > http://www.freeswitchsolutions.com
>>> >
>>> > 
>>> > 
>>> >
>>> > Official FreeSWITCH Sites
>>> > http://www.freeswitch.org
>>> > http://wiki.freeswitch.org
>>> > http://www.cluecon.com
>>> >
>>> > FreeSWITCH-users mailing list
>>> > FreeSWITCH-users at lists.freeswitch.org
>>> > http://lists.freeswitch.org/mailman/listinfo/freeswitch-users
>>> > UNSUBSCRIBE:
>>> http://lists.freeswitch.org/mailman/options/freeswitch-users
>>> > http://www.freeswitch.org
>>>
>>>
>>> _________________________________________________________________________
>>> Professional FreeSWITCH Consulting Services:
>>> consulting at freeswitch.org
>>> http://www.freeswitchsolutions.com
>>>
>>> 
>>> 
>>>
>>> Official FreeSWITCH Sites
>>> http://www.freeswitch.org
>>> http://wiki.freeswitch.org
>>> http://www.cluecon.com
>>>
>>> FreeSWITCH-users mailing list
>>> FreeSWITCH-users at lists.freeswitch.org
>>> http://lists.freeswitch.org/mailman/listinfo/freeswitch-users
>>> UNSUBSCRIBE:http://lists.freeswitch.org/mailman/options/freeswitch-users
>>> http://www.freeswitch.org
>>>
>>>
>>
>> _________________________________________________________________________
>> Professional FreeSWITCH Consulting Services:
>> consulting at freeswitch.org
>> http://www.freeswitchsolutions.com
>>
>> 
>> 
>>
>> Official FreeSWITCH Sites
>> http://www.freeswitch.org
>> http://wiki.freeswitch.org
>> http://www.cluecon.com
>>
>> FreeSWITCH-users mailing list
>> FreeSWITCH-users at lists.freeswitch.org
>> http://lists.freeswitch.org/mailman/listinfo/freeswitch-users
>> UNSUBSCRIBE:http://lists.freeswitch.org/mailman/options/freeswitch-users
>> http://www.freeswitch.org
>>
>>
>
>
> --
> Anthony Minessale II
>
>http://www.freeswitch.org/http://www.cluecon.com/> http://twitter.com/FreeSWITCH
> ☞ irc.freenode.net #freeswitch
>
> ClueCon Weekly Development Call
> ☎ sip:888 at conference.freeswitch.org  ☎ +19193869900
>
>
> _________________________________________________________________________
> Professional FreeSWITCH Consulting Services:
> consulting at freeswitch.org
> http://www.freeswitchsolutions.com
>
> 
> 
>
> Official FreeSWITCH Sites
> http://www.freeswitch.org
> http://wiki.freeswitch.org
> http://www.cluecon.com
>
> FreeSWITCH-users mailing list
> FreeSWITCH-users at lists.freeswitch.org
> http://lists.freeswitch.org/mailman/listinfo/freeswitch-users
> UNSUBSCRIBE:http://lists.freeswitch.org/mailman/options/freeswitch-users
> http://www.freeswitch.org
>
>
-------------- next part --------------
An HTML attachment was scrubbed...
URL: http://lists.freeswitch.org/pipermail/freeswitch-users/attachments/20131211/fee2f2a1/attachment-0001.html 
-------------- next part --------------
A non-text attachment was scrubbed...
Name: not available
Type: image/png
Size: 16423 bytes
Desc: not available
Url : http://lists.freeswitch.org/pipermail/freeswitch-users/attachments/20131211/fee2f2a1/attachment-0001.png 


Join us at ClueCon 2013 Aug 6-8, 2013
More information about the FreeSWITCH-users mailing list